Abstract: From June 1946 to August 1958, the U.S. Department of Defense and
the U.S. Atomic Energy Commission (AEC) conducted nuclear weapons tests
in the Northern Marshall Islands. On 1 March 1954, BRAVO, an
above-ground test in the Castle series, produced high levels of
radioactive material, some of which subsequently fell on Rongelap and
Utirik Atolls due to an unexpected wind shift. On 3 March 1954, the
inhabitants of these atolls were moved out of the affected area. They
later returned to Utirik in June 1954 and to Rongelap in June 1957.
Comprehensive environmental and personnel radiological monitoring
programs were initiated in the mid 1950s by Brookhaven National
Laboratory to ensure that body burdens of the exposed Marshallese
subjects remained within AEC guidelines. Their body-burden histories
and calculated activity ingestion rate patterns post-return are
presented along with estimates of internal committed effective dose
equivalents.

External exposure data are also included.

In addition,

relationships between body burden or urine-activity concentration and

declining continuous intake were developed.;
